verb
- to convert information, images, or sounds into digital form that can be processed by a computer
- to treat a patient with digitalis or similar heart medication
Usage: medical
Examples
- The library plans to digitalize its entire collection of historical documents.
- We need to digitalize these old photographs before they deteriorate further.
- The company will digitalize all paper records by the end of the year.
- They digitalized the analog audio tapes to preserve the recordings.
- The museum is working to digitalize its archives for online access.
- The doctor decided to digitalize the patient to regulate their heart rhythm.
